[0020] Such as figure 1 As shown, the double break point low-voltage contactor contact structure using a flexible connection device includes a first static contact unit 101, a second static contact unit 102, a first moving contact unit 201, and a second moving contact unit. 202, the elastic mechanism 4, the linkage device 5, the soft connection 6 and the insulating support 7; the first moving contact unit 201 and the second moving contact unit 202 are fixedly connected through the soft connection 6; the elastic mechanism 4 is fixedly installed Between the first moving contact unit 201 and the second moving contact unit 202 ; the insulating support 7 is fixedly connected to the elastic mechanism 4 via the linkage device 5 .
[0021] The elastic mechanism 4 of the present invention can adopt a leaf spring structure.
